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

By analyzing characteristics of tail gas from sulfur recovery unit in coal chemical industry, combining with factors affecting the acid dew point, the paper obtains concentration of SO2 , SO3 and H2O are the main influencing factors in acid dew point. After comparing and estimating with A.G.Okkes formula and flue gas acid dew point computational formula, when SO3 volume fraction is 10×10-6 , H.A.bapahoba estimation formula could estimate acid dew point of tail gas from sulfur recovery unit better, which can direct practical engineering applications.
